Vuori Appoints Andrew Campion to Board of Directors

The addition of the industry leader reinforces the brand’s continued momentum and further fuels its strategic growth priorities

Vuori, the performance and lifestyle brand known for its coastal California-inspired style, today announced the appointment of Andrew Campion to its Board of Directors and a member of its Audit Committee. For over 17 years, Andy served in executive leadership roles at Nike Inc. (NYSE: NKE), including as Chief Operating Officer, Chief Financial Officer, and head of global strategy.

Prior to Nike, Campion was with The Walt Disney Company (NYSE: DIS), serving as its Senior Vice President of Corporate Development. Currently, Andy is the Chairman and CEO of Unrivaled Sports, a leading and fast-growing youth sports portfolio of brands and businesses.

Campion currently serves on the Boards of Directors of Starbucks Coffee Company (NASDAQ: SBUX), Williams-Sonoma, Inc. (NYSE: WSM), the Los Angeles 2028 Olympic and Paralympic Games, and the UCLA Anderson School of Management.

Since being established in 2015, Vuori has strategically positioned itself as a category disruptor in the activewear market by offering a differentiated and more versatile perspective on performance apparel. After garnering widespread attention and loyalty from consumers in the United States, the brand has expanded its global omnichannel presence through a growing network of brick-and-mortar locations and a robust network of distributors.

Recently surpassing the 100-store milestone, Vuori expects to methodically build its fleet of locations in the U.S. each year. Additionally, by the end of 2026, it expects to add a significant number of store locations outside of the U.S., cementing its momentum and presence globally. This comes as the brand recently opened flagship stores in London and Shanghai with plans to open stores in Seoul and Beijing by the end of 2025.

About Vuori

Born in the beachside town of Encinitas, California, Vuori draws inspiration from its vibrant community, active lifestyle, and the natural playground that surrounds it. The brand creates premium performance apparel and elevated everyday styles—each crafted with intention, quality, and a fabric-first approach—to strike the perfect balance between functionality and simplicity. Vuori was founded in 2015 by Joe Kudla in a humble garage office just two blocks from the ocean. What started in a small “garoffice” quickly grew into a powerful vision: to build a values-driven brand rooted in connection, balance, and the pursuit of an extraordinary life. Today, Vuori is available in more than 18 countries worldwide, found in Vuori stores, on vuoriclothing.com, and through a network of national and regional retail partners.
